Oracle 12cR2:云驱动的革新 - 多租户、内存优化与高效性能提升

需积分: 9 5 下载量 136 浏览量 更新于2024-07-18 收藏 11.03MB PPTX 举报
Oracle Database 12c Release 2 (12cR2) 是一个重要的里程碑,它在多个方面引入了革新性的特性和功能,旨在提高性能、降低成本并适应云计算环境。以下是一些关键的新功能亮点: 1. **多租户架构**:12cR2引入了全面的多租户支持,包括在线克隆、刷新和在线迁移,这使得数据库管理员可以更灵活地管理和维护多个数据库环境(Pluggable Database, PDB),同时保持资源的高效利用。 2. **成本效率提升**:支持高达4096个PDB,使得大型企业可以处理更多的业务需求,且数据库内存In-Memory技术的应用,显著提升了查询速度,相比12.1版最多可提升60倍性能。 3. **敏捷性与自动化**:新版本引入了SaaS应用容器,便于部署和管理应用程序,以及ADO(Automatic Data Optimization)自动数据优化,减轻了手动调优的负担。 4. **存储优化**:内存列格式被纳入ActiveDataGuard,增强了数据一致性;智能压缩和数据自动分层功能帮助企业优化存储空间和管理复杂的数据结构。 5. **高可用性与灾备**:DataGuard FarSync提供了远距离数据保护,即使在灾难情况下也能实现零数据丢失,确保业务连续性。 6. **应用程序集成与透明性**:12cR2通过提供失败事务重放、数据编辑和动态遮盖等功能,增强了对应用程序的适应性,使其对模式变化更为敏感,并能进行复杂的行间模式分析。 7. **面向云的发布**:新版本特别针对云计算环境设计,例如推出了Exadata Express Cloud Service、Database Cloud Services、Exadata Cloud Machine等云服务,以及原生数据分片和弹性扩展,支持大规模应用。 8. **历史回顾与演变**:OracleDatabase12cR2是继1990年代以来,Oracle在互联网客户端-服务器架构上的又一次重大迭代,体现了从早期的单一数据库到现在的云时代数据库整合和统一管理的发展趋势。 Oracle 12cR2通过一系列创新性功能,强化了数据库在现代IT环境中的核心地位,无论是在单体架构还是分布式云环境中,都能提供卓越的性能、可靠性和灵活性。这些特点使企业能够更好地应对日益增长的数据处理需求和复杂的应用环境。